The relic burned within me, but it soothed me just the same. My holy purpose revealed - to bring this last fragment of our God to my People! He would never return to us, but forever more we would be the people of Amyhdahl, our Fallen Creator. I returned the way I came, leaving the Tomb of the Last Gamble behind - it held nothing for me, now. My new friends trailed behind me, as silent as ever, but now I imagined them walking in reverent peace. I hoped that any part of them that held me accountable would forgive me my errors. -O- For the first time in… quite some time, I crested the lip of the pit of the Last Gamble and surveyed the land. I could scarcely believe my eye, such was the magnitude of the change visited upon the terrain. Mountains where there were none before, Water in abundance, stands of Glassforest shifted from my memory. My powerful senses picked up strands of unfamiliar sounds - speech? Not Fortugnat, certainly, but then I didn't need my senses to find them. I just knew. -O- I approached my People alone. I judged that the appearance of the Anomalice would be… upsetting... to the Fortugnat, but there was time enough later for introductions. In time, both of my Peoples would be one, reunited once again. For now, I would make contact. Their King, returned. Just look at them, cringing out there in the dark. I did not recognize their tools, the strange coverings on their bodies, but I recognized them. I stood before them, arms wide in welcoming… but they did not see me, distracted by their toils, eyes unable to pierce the gloom like mine. I stepped closer, and at last the light of the stars revealed me to them. They broke and ran, and I did not blame them. They must think me the mad brute who left them so long ago! I laughed, then, and bade them to stop. They froze in place, mid-run. I called them to me, and they came, straining against my compulsion. They need not fear, I told them, for I was the herald of their God, returned to them. Amyhdahl was dead, but in His death was our new life! They shivered in place, and one tried to speak. I graciously allowed it, unprepared for what came next. “Who is Amyhdahl? Who are you!?”
